Braddock Locks and Dam Septic Tank Pumping Service

ID: W911WN25QA016 • Type: Synopsis Solicitation

Description

1.1 GeneralThe Braddock Locks and Dam project is located on the Monongahela River between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ania and McKeesport, Pennsylvania, in Braddock, PA, Allegheny County, PA. The Project address is 11th Street, Braddock, PA 15104-1704.1.2 Scope of ContractThe intent of this contract is to pump out the septic holding tank, then, remove and dispose of all effluent and debris in an acceptable manner at a licensed disposal facility in accordance with all state and federal rules, regulations, laws, and specifications of this contract.The work shall include the furnishing of all materials, equipment, and supplies and the performance of all labor and all incidentals necessary to pump and clean the septic holding tank at the Braddock Locks and Dam project.1.3 Location and DescriptionSee attached Reference Drawings and Photos. The Wastewater System Area is shown in the Solicitations Attachment 1- Reference Drawings.The holding tank holds 500 gallons of sewage. This site is open year-round. The holding tank shall be pumped once every 7 days, 52 times per year.The Base contract is for one year, with options for each of the next three years. Quotes shall be firm fixed price. Price shall include all mileage costs, if applicable. Option lines may be awarded, depending upon funding.1.4 General RequirementsThe Contractor will provide all labor, supplies, supervision, materials, equipment, and transportation necessary to provide pumping of the holding tank. The Contractor shall provide a schedule for the year within 10 business days of contract award, and exercising of option years. Any requested changes to the schedule shall be submitted within 5 business days of request and invoices will be submitted within 30 days of service. The Contractor will provide pumping and disposal services for pumped wastewater material and debris pulled from the holding tank. All wastewater shall be disposed of offsite in a legal manner. The Contractor shall be properly licensed and is responsible for obtaining all necessary permits and licenses for pumping, hauling, and disposing of the effluent. Contractor shall pump all wet effluent from the holding tank. The holding tank must be pumped dry, with less than one inch of effluent remaining in the holding tank for each pumping.The Contractor shall be responsible for preventing spillage during pumping and hauling of all waste material. Handling of all waste material shall be in accordance with all applicable health regulations. Upon completion of pumping the holding tank, Contractor shall clean up any spillage on the surrounding soil.2 Location, Description, and Frequency of Service2.1 LocationBraddock Locks and Dam is located at river mile 11.3 near the community of Braddock, Pa. The tank is located between the maintenance and administration buildings, which are situated along the right descending bank of the river. Road access to the project is from 11th Street, leading south from Washington Ave.2.2 Description One (1) holding tank, approximately 500 gallons2.3 FrequencyPump once every 7 days, 52 times within the 365-day Period of Performance. 5 services on as needed basis are included. The Site POC shall coordinate with the Contractor for these services if needed and response time shall be within 24 hours.3 Contractor Furnished MaterialsThe Contractor will provide all supervision, labor, tools, transportation, equipment, and supplies required to pump the holding tank in accordance with the requirements of this contract.4 Damage ReportsAll instances where Government materials, supplies, property, and/or equipment are damaged, shall be reported immediately to the Contracting Officer and Lockmaster.
Background
The Braddock Locks and Dam project is situated on the Monongahela River between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ania and McKeesport, Pennsylvania, specifically in Braddock, PA, Allegheny County. The project aims to maintain the wastewater management system at the facility by ensuring proper disposal of sewage and effluent from a septic holding tank.

Work Details
The contractor is responsible for pumping out the septic holding tank, which has a capacity of 500 gallons, and disposing of all effluent and debris at a licensed disposal facility in compliance with state and federal regulations. The work includes:

1) Providing all necessary materials, equipment, supplies, labor, and supervision for pumping and cleaning the septic tank;

2) Pumping the holding tank once every 7 days (52 times per year), with additional services as needed;

3) Ensuring that less than one inch of effluent remains in the tank after pumping;

4) Preventing spillage during pumping and hauling operations;

5) Cleaning up any spillage on surrounding soil post-pumping;

6) Obtaining all necessary permits for pumping, hauling, and disposal;

7) Submitting a work schedule within 10 business days of contract award;

8) Reporting any damage to government property immediately.

Period of Performance
The base contract will commence upon award for a period of one year (365 days), with options for three additional years available depending on funding.

Place of Performance
The contract will be performed at the Braddock Locks and Dam located at 11th Street, Braddock, PA 15104-1704.
